发表评论取消回复
相关阅读
相关 Java泛型:运行时类型擦除的常见问题和解决方案
Java泛型是在编译时提供类型安全的一种机制,它允许开发者在编译时检查类型错误,而不是在运行时。然而,Java的泛型实现采用了类型擦除(Type Erasure),这意味着在运
相关 Java泛型在运行时的类型擦除实例
Java泛型在编译时提供了类型安全,但在运行时,为了保持向后兼容性,Java使用类型擦除来实现泛型。这意味着泛型信息在编译后会被擦除,运行时不再保留泛型的具体类型信息。以下是一
相关 Java泛型应用中的类型擦除问题
Java泛型是在J2SE1.5中引入的一个特性,它允许在编译时进行类型检查,从而避免在运行时出现ClassCastException。泛型提供了一种方式来编写类型安全的代码,同
相关 Java泛型编程:类型擦除与运行时问题
在Java中,泛型是一种强大的工具,用于创建可以存储不同类型数据的容器。然而,这种强大特性也会导致一些类型擦除和运行时问题。 1. 类型擦除: - 泛型参数在编译期被擦
相关 Java泛型:何时会导致运行时类型擦除问题
Java泛型在设计时可以提供许多好处,如代码重用、类型安全等。然而,如果使用不当或超出一定的范围,就可能导致运行时类型擦除(Type Erasure)的问题。 以下是可能导致
相关 Java泛型编程中的类型擦除和运行时问题实例
在Java的泛型编程中,"类型擦除"和"运行时问题"是两个重要的概念。 1. 类型擦除: 这是在编译时发生的过程。虽然代码中使用的是泛型,但当编译器生成字节码(如JVM
相关 Java泛型使用误区:类型擦除与运行时问题
在Java编程中,泛型是实现类型安全的重要手段。然而,使用泛型时也存在一些误区,主要涉及类型擦除和运行时问题。 1. **类型擦除**: - 误区:很多人认为在编译阶段
相关 Java泛型在编译时的类型擦除问题
Java泛型的类型擦除问题主要是由于Java编译器对泛型进行的一种优化。 1. **编译阶段**:当Java代码被编译成字节码时,泛型的实际类型会被替换为某种具体类型(如`O
相关 java中的泛型类型擦除
![format_png][] 大家好,我是雄雄,今天给大家分享的是:java的泛型是类型擦除的。 写在前面 那么何为类型擦除?类型擦除就是在编译期明确去掉所编程序的类型
相关 Guava中的TypeToken,解决泛型运行时类型擦除的问题
关于对于Type的理解 泛型是一种类型 1. 关于Type,是一个标示接口,该标示接口描述的意义是代表所有的类型 pub
还没有评论,来说两句吧...